Keeping Cavities and Tooth Decay at Bay
Did you know that cavities and tooth decay are among the most common oral health issues worldwide? Without regular dental checkups, you might not even realize there’s a problem until it’s too late. During a routine checkup, your dentist will meticulously examine your teeth for signs of cavities and decay. Even with the most diligent brushing and flossing routine, some areas of the mouth may be missed, leading to plaque buildup.

Gum Health: The Foundation of a Healthy Mouth
Gum disease can sneak up on you if you don’t regularly attend dental checkups. Dentists are trained to spot early signs of gum issues which, if left untreated, can lead to serious diseases such as gingivitis or periodontitis. The symptoms of gum disease might be subtle, from intermittent bleeding while brushing to persistent bad breath.
Regular visits ensure that any threat to your gums is managed timely. Impact on Your General Health
Oral health is often dubbed the window to your overall health. Conditions like heart disease, diabetes, and complications during pregnancy have been linked to poor oral hygiene. Regular dental visits are a proactive approach to keeping systemic diseases in check.
Your dentist may also notice signs of nutritional deficiencies during a checkup. Such expertise ensures that any required dietary changes are recommended before they affect your wellbeing seriously. Prioritizing dental care ensures that you’re not just avoiding oral issues, but also safeguarding your general health.
